The .nyc domain extension is a top-level domain (TLD) that was introduced to target the residents, businesses, and organizations in New York City. It provides a unique city-specific identification for the users, reinforcing a strong connection to the city. The .nyc TLD, launched in 2014, is managed and operated by Neustar, an American technology company, under the authority of The City of New York. With stringent eligibility requirements, one has to have a physical address in New York City to qualify to use this domain extension. This exclusivity has helped in maintaining a strong New York identity in the digital realm.

All you need to know about .nyc domains

The .nyc domain is a top-level domain (TLD) extension specific to the city of New York, marking the first instance of an American city having its own unique domain. It was introduced in March 2014 as a way to represent the unique identity of New York City online. Interestingly, this domain is subject to geographical restrictions, meaning it can only be registered by businesses, organizations, and individuals with a bona fide presence in New York City. Currently, over 75,000 domains are registered under the .nyc extension, making it one of the most commonly used city-specific TLDs in the world. This domain extension was launched as a part of the larger plan to allow cities around the world establish their own unique digital identities.

.nyc Frequently Asked Questions

A .nyc domain name is a top-level domain (TLD) for the city of New York. It is part of a program implemented by the city to enhance local businesses, services, and residents. To register a .nyc domain, the owner must have a physical address in New York City.
Using a .nyc domain name extension can be beneficial for localizing your business or brand within New York City. It can help you stand out from competitors and appeal specifically to NYC audience. It may also boost local search engine optimization (SEO), making your website more visible to folks searching in and around the city.
To purchase a .nyc domain name, one must be either a resident of New York City or have a physical address in the city. This includes businesses, organizations, or individuals. A Proof of presence within the five boroughs of New York City is required to secure a .nyc domain.
